
Steroli
Gli steroli sono un sottogruppo degli steroidi con un gruppo idrossile in posizione 3 dell'anello A. Sono componenti chiave delle membrane cellulari, dove modulano la fluidità e la permeabilità, e servono come precursori di molecole biologicamente attive come ormoni e vitamine. Gli steroli sono anche importanti nello studio del metabolismo del colesterolo e delle malattie correlate.
